製造業廢棄物管理市場成長推動因素

由於工業活動的增加、監管框架的加強以及全球範圍內循環經濟實踐的快速普及,全球製造業廢棄物管理市場持續穩步增長。根據 2024 年的報告,預計 2024 年市場規模將達到 1.8465 億美元,2025 年將增至 1.9517 億美元,到 2032 年將達到 2.7891 億美元。這一增長反映了 5.23% 的複合年增長率,其推動因素包括危險廢棄物產生量的增加、廢棄物處理技術的進步以及全球製造業生態系統中可持續發展舉措的擴展。

製造業廢棄物包括危險和非危險材料,例如化學品、有害物質、廢金屬、包裝廢棄物、電子廢棄物和醫療廢棄物。危險廢棄物對公眾健康和生態系統構成重大威脅,其在化工、製藥、汽車和電子產業的日益增長的產生量是推動市場發展的主要因素。威立雅、蘇伊士和Clean Harbors等領先供應商在全球40多個國家開展業務,為大型工業客戶提供先進的危險廢棄物管理服務。

市場動態

市場推動因素

市場成長的關鍵推動因素是危險廢棄物和電子廢棄物的產生量不斷增加。現代化的製造工廠,尤其是在電子、化學、製藥和汽車行業,會產生大量的危險廢物,這些廢物需要嚴格的處理、處置和處置程序。 2025年6月,威立雅宣布大幅擴大其危險廢棄物處理能力(到2030年每年新增53萬噸),凸顯了全球對先進廢棄物處理日益增長的需求。

市場限制因子

高昂的初始投資成本是市場擴張的一大挑戰,尤其是對於涉及垃圾分類、回收機械、危險廢棄物處理廠和排放控制系統的先進設施而言。營運成本,包括廢棄物運輸、熟練勞動力、維護和合規費用,也給中小製造商帶來了沉重的財務負擔,限制了他們採用先進的廢棄物管理系統。

市場機會

技術進步正透過智慧廢棄物管理解決方案創造新的機會。物聯網賦能的垃圾箱、人工智慧驅動的分類機、即時監控系統、自動化和預測分析的引入,正在改變製造商追蹤和優化廢物處理的方式。 2023年11月,威立雅宣布推出一項基於人工智慧的數位化解決方案,旨在提高其工業客戶的水、能源和廢棄物管理效率。

市場趨勢

重塑產業的關鍵趨勢是向循環經濟和零廢棄物倡議的快速轉型。製造商正加速從傳統的線性模式轉型為 "減少、再利用、回收、再生" 系統。循環經濟實踐有助於降低對原材料的依賴和生產成本,同時促進永續發展。因此,對材料回收和循環利用基礎設施的日益重視正在推動市場需求。

Growth Factors of manufacturing waste management Market

The global manufacturing waste management market is experiencing steady expansion driven by rising industrial activity, stricter regulatory frameworks, and the rapid adoption of circular economy practices worldwide. According to the 2024 report, the market was valued at USD 184.65 million in 2024, is projected to increase to USD 195.17 million in 2025, and is expected to reach USD 278.91 million by 2032. This growth reflects a CAGR of 5.23%, supported by rising hazardous waste generation, advancements in waste treatment technologies, and growing sustainability commitments across global manufacturing ecosystems.

Manufacturing waste consists of both hazardous and non-hazardous materials, including chemicals, toxic substances, metal scrap, packaging waste, e-waste, and biomedical waste. Hazardous waste poses significant threats to public health and ecosystems, and its growing volume across chemical, pharmaceutical, automotive, and electronics industries is a key market driver. Major vendors such as Veolia, SUEZ, and Clean Harbors operate globally across 40+ countries, serving large industrial clients with advanced hazardous waste management services.

Market Dynamics

Market Drivers

A major factor driving market growth is the increase in hazardous and e-waste generation. Modern manufacturing facilities, especially in electronics, chemicals, pharmaceuticals, and automotive sectors, generate substantial quantities of hazardous waste requiring strict handling, treatment, and disposal procedures. In June 2025, Veolia announced a large expansion of its hazardous waste treatment capacity-adding 530,000 tons of annual capacity by 2030-highlighting the escalating global need for high-level waste treatment.

Market Restraints

Market expansion is challenged by high initial investment costs, especially for advanced facilities involving waste segregation, recycling machinery, hazardous waste treatment plants, and emissions control systems. Operational expenses-such as waste transport, skilled labor, maintenance, and compliance-also create a financial burden for small and mid-sized manufacturers, limiting adoption of sophisticated waste systems.

Market Opportunities

Technological advancements are creating new opportunities through smart waste management solutions. The adoption of IoT-enabled bins, AI-driven sorting machines, real-time monitoring systems, automation, and predictive analytics is transforming how manufacturers track and optimize waste handling. In November 2023, Veolia introduced an AI-based digital solution to improve water, energy, and waste management efficiency across industrial clients.

Market Trends

A key trend reshaping the industry is the rapid shift toward circular economy and zero-waste initiatives. Manufacturers are increasingly moving from a traditional linear model to a "reduce-reuse-recycle-recover" system. Circular practices help reduce raw material dependency and production costs, while also promoting sustainability. Growing emphasis on material recovery and recycling infrastructure is therefore boosting market demand.

Segmentation Analysis

By Waste Type

  • Hazardous waste leads the market due to high regulatory pressure and complex disposal needs in chemical, pharmaceutical, and electronics manufacturing.
  • Non-hazardous waste is the second-largest segment, driven by the large volume of organic waste, metal scrap, packaging materials, and e-waste.

By Services

  • Landfills dominate since they remain cost-effective in regions with lower regulatory pressure.
  • Recycling is the fastest-growing segment as manufacturers invest in resource recovery and circular systems to lower operating costs.

Regional Outlook

North America

North America is a mature market with strict EPA-driven compliance standards. Growing industrialization and sustainability initiatives are encouraging adoption of waste-to-resource and recycling solutions.

United States

The U.S. generates some of the world's highest per-capita waste volumes across industrial, medical, and e-waste categories. There is a major shift away from landfilling toward recycling, composting, and waste-to-energy systems.

Europe

The region's diverse industrial base-including electronics, chemicals, automotive, and textiles-drives significant waste generation. The European Green Deal is accelerating circular economy practices, fostering increased demand for recycling and recovery services.

Asia Pacific

Asia Pacific dominates the market, driven by rapid industrialization in China, India, South Korea, and Southeast Asia. The region's smart city and industrial corridor projects are creating large-scale demand for modern waste management systems.

Latin America

Growing manufacturing activities in Brazil, Mexico, Argentina, and Chile are increasing waste volumes. Governments are tightening regulations on hazardous and industrial waste, supporting market growth.

Middle East & Africa

GCC countries (Saudi Arabia, UAE, Qatar, Kuwait) are diversifying beyond oil and expanding industries that generate significant waste. Rising investments in manufacturing and construction are boosting demand for waste management services.
